How many web development companies are there in the United States?
According to the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S), there are around 120,000 web development companies in the United States, with an expected 7% growth rate from 2024 to 2034. The U.S. also saw over 5.5 million new startups in 2023, many in professional and technical services, including web development.
With 83% of Gen Z developers using AI tools to create smarter and faster solutions, the web development industry is evolving rapidly. For businesses looking to connect with skilled talent and growing startups, California, Texas, Washington, and New York remain the top hubs driving innovation and digital growth.

What Factors Should I Consider While Hiring The Best Website Development Agency In The United States?
Hiring the right web development agency in the United States is not just about getting a website built. It means working with experts who can turn your ideas into a website that works well, looks good, and helps your business grow.
7 Factors can consider while hiring USA web developers
- Portfolio and Experience
Review the agency’s past projects to assess the quality, creativity, and variety of websites they’ve built. Check if they have experience in your industry, as this can provide valuable insights and allow them to create more effective, tailored solutions.
- Technical Expertise
Ensure the agency has strong skills in relevant programming languages like HTML, CSS, and JavaScript, as well as frameworks such as React, Angular, or Vue.js. They should also be experienced with website builders or CMS tools that match your project requirements, such as WordPress, Shopify, or custom solutions.
- Client Testimonials and Reviews
Look for Customer feedback on platforms like Google, LinkedIn, or other B2B review sites like SelectedFirms. Positive reviews and detailed testimonials indicate credibility, reliability, and a history of delivering successful projects.
- Communication and Project Management
Effective communication is critical. The agency should clearly explain technical aspects, respond promptly, and provide a transparent project timeline with defined milestones. Ask how they handle changes, unexpected delays, and client collaboration throughout the project.
- Budget and Pricing Transparency
Understand their pricing models, whether fixed, hourly, or milestone-based, and request a detailed breakdown of costs. Ensure there are no hidden fees, and confirm that the scope of work matches the price quoted.
- Post-Development Support and Maintenance
A strong agency offers ongoing support and maintenance after launch, including updates, security checks, and troubleshooting, to keep your website running smoothly and efficiently.
- Customization and Flexibility
The best agencies provide personalization solutions instead of generic templates. They should listen to your ideas, adapt to your unique needs, and offer innovative approaches to achieve your business goals.
By evaluating these factors carefully, you can select a U.S.-based web development agency that not only builds a functional and attractive website but also supports your long-term digital growth.
How much do top-rated web development company in the United States cost?
Top-rated web development companies in the United States generally charge between $75 and $200 per hour, with total project costs ranging from $10,000 to over $100,000, depending on scope and complexity. On the basis of the SelectedFirms data, the average cost of a full web development project in the U.S. is around $66,500, but this can vary widely based on factors such as website complexity, technology stack, team experience, and company type.
These agencies often provide high-quality design, secure development, and long-term support, which together contribute to higher pricing compared to offshore or freelance developers.
Let’s elaborate on the pricing discussion on the basis of different perspectives.
1. Cost by Website Complexity
- Basic Websites (Small Business or Portfolio Sites): $3,000 – $8,000
- Mid-Level Websites (Corporate or CMS-Based): $12,000 – $45,000
- E-commerce or Advanced Websites: $25,000 – $90,000
- Enterprise or SaaS Platforms: $80,000 – $250,000+
2. Cost by Tech Stack Usage
- Open-Source Stacks (LAMP, MEAN, MERN): $10,000 – $60,000
- .NET or Java-Based Solutions: $30,000 – $120,000
- Python or Ruby on Rails Projects: $20,000 – $100,000
3. Cost by Experience Level
- Junior to Mid-Level Developers: $50 – $100 per hour
- Senior Developers or Specialized Experts: $150 – $250+ per hour
4. Cost by Type of Company
- Freelancers or Small Local Agencies: $25 – $75 per hour
- Mid-Sized U.S. Development Firms: $75 – $150 per hour
- Top-Tier or Enterprise Agencies: $150 – $250+ per hour
What are the essential questions I should ask before getting website development services in the USA?
Before hiring a web development agency in the U.S., ask key questions to understand their process, skills, and experience. This helps you choose a reliable partner who can meet your goals and deliver quality results.
Here are the essential questions grouped by topic:
Strategy & Experience
- What is your strategy for building a website that supports my business goals?
- What research will you do on my business, target audience, and competitors?
- Can you show me case studies of similar projects you’ve completed?
- Do you have experience working in my industry or with businesses like mine?
- Which Content Management System (CMS) do you recommend, and why?
- Will you build a custom site from scratch or use pre-built templates?
Process & Workflow
- How will you manage the project, and who will be my main point of contact?
- What is your usual workflow and timeline for a project like this?
- What assets will you need from me before starting (texts, images, branding)?
- How many rounds of revisions are included in the process?
Costs & Ownership
- What is your pricing structure, and what services are included?
- Are there additional costs (hosting, maintenance, third-party services)?
- After completion, will I have full ownership of the website and its content?
Technical & Security
- How will you ensure the website is fast, responsive on mobile devices, and SEO-friendly?
- What security measures will you implement to protect the site and its data?
- How will you plan for scalability as my business grows?
- Will the website include an SSL certificate and other standard security features?
Post-Launch & Support
- What kind of support and maintenance do you offer after the site is live?
- What is your typical response time when issues arise?
- Do you offer ongoing maintenance plans (updates, backups, uptime monitoring)?
- Will you provide training so I or my team can manage content afterward?
What Red Flags Should Be Watched While Hiring Website Development Agencies In The United States?
Imagine walking into a dealership and the salesperson promises the moon—with no details. The same goes for choosing a web development agency; there are certain signs such as non-transparent pricing, an overpromising nature, a lack of communication, and many more.
Here are some warning signs that should make you pause and reconsider:
-
Lack of Portfolio or Case Studies: If a company can’t show examples of past work, it’s a big red flag.
-
Poor Communication: Slow, unclear, or inconsistent replies can indicate issues down the road.
-
Unclear Pricing or Hidden Fees: Genuine agencies are transparent about costs. Beware of confusing pricing and surprise charges.
-
Negative or Missing Client Reviews: A lack of positive testimonials or many bad reviews can tell you a lot.
-
No Post-Launch Support: If an agency doesn’t offer ongoing maintenance, updates, or help after launch, you may be stranded with future problems.
-
Outdated Technology or Practices: If they use old-school methods or don’t keep up with new tech, or are scared to use AI or trending methods your project may fall behind.
-
Ownership Issues: Always confirm you’ll have full control and access to your site after launch.
- Overpromising Nature: Watch out for agencies that guarantee unrealistic results, ultra-fast timelines, or “too good to be true” outcomes. Promises without a solid plan or previous success to back them up can spell disappointment.
Spotting these red flags early helps you choose a trustworthy partner who delivers real results.
